Weather Considerations



When planning a business paint project, climate considerations are crucial. You need to keep an eye on temperature and moisture levels, as they can significantly influence paint application and drying times.

Preferably, you intend to schedule your job during moderate weather-- temperature levels in between 50 ° F and 85 ° F are generally best for many paints. Severe warmth can trigger the paint to completely dry as well quickly, leading to fractures, while low temperature levels can decrease drying, allowing dust and particles to pick the wet surface.

Rain is one more variable to consider. Painting outside throughout damp problems can result in poor adhesion and a greater opportunity of peeling off later. It's important to check the forecast and plan your job for a stretch of dry days.

Wind can additionally be an issue, especially if you're working with spray paint, as it can cause overspray and unequal insurance coverage.

Lastly, seasonal modifications can modify your timeline. Spring and loss usually offer one of the most positive problems, so consider these seasons when scheduling your business painting task.

Seasonal Trends and Demand



Understanding seasonal fads and need is crucial for planning your commercial painting job successfully. Various seasons bring differing climate condition, which can considerably influence the timing of your task.

Springtime and early summertime usually existing the very best opportunities for exterior paint, as the temperatures are light and dry. This is when need usually peaks, so organizing early can ensure you protect the right specialist at a competitive rate.

Autumn can additionally be a great time for exterior job, as many services seek to freshen their spaces prior to winter months. However, as temperature levels drop, you might face delays as a result of weather constraints.

On the other hand, winter season is usually an off-peak period, making it a cost-effective time for indoor paint. With less jobs on the table, contractors are commonly more versatile and can prioritize your demands.

Keep in mind that vacations and local occasions can affect availability, so strategy in advance.
